Panamanian vs Cheyenne Male Unemployment Correlation Chart
The statistical analysis conducted on geographies consisting of 280,561,708 people shows a moderate positive correlation between the proportion of Panamanians and unemployment rate among males in the United States with a correlation coefficient (R) of 0.420 and weighted average of 5.6%. Similarly, the statistical analysis conducted on geographies consisting of 80,585,658 people shows a substantial positive correlation between the proportion of Cheyenne and unemployment rate among males in the United States with a correlation coefficient (R) of 0.571 and weighted average of 9.8%, a difference of 74.9%.
